Red Sox place infielder Christian Arroyo on 10-day injured list

Boston recalls infielder Jonathan Araúz from Triple-A Worcester

May 9th, 2021

BOSTON, MA – The Boston Red Sox today placed infielder Christian Arroyo on the 10-day injured list due to a left hand contusion, retroactive to May 7. To fill Arroyo’s spot on the active roster, the club recalled infielder Jonathan Araúz from Triple-A Worcester.

Chief Baseball Officer Chaim Bloom made the announcement.

Arroyo, 25, has hit .275 (19-for-69) with a .710 OPS in 23 games for the Red Sox this season, making each of his 18 starts at second base. Claimed off waivers from Cleveland on August 13, 2020, the right-handed hitter has appeared in 108 major league games with the San Francisco Giants (2017), Tampa Bay Rays (2018-19), Cleveland (2020), and Boston (2020-21).

Araúz, 22, made his major league debut with the Red Sox in 2020 after being selected by the club in the 2019 Rule 5 Draft. In five games with Worcester this season, the switch-hitter is 3-for-15 (.200) with one walk. A native of Panama, he appeared in 25 games with Boston in 2020 and hit .250 (18-for-72) with one home run, making 13 starts at second base, two at third base, and two at shortstop.
